Google Marketplace and Google Apps on Archos 5 Internet Tablet with Android
A user on the forum.archosfans.com has released a trick using the ADB USB developer debugging tools for installing the complete Google Experience Google Marketplace and Google Apps, including Gmail, Gtalk, Google Maps and other Google apps on the Archos 5 Internet Tablet with Android, even though Archos is still only running on Android 1.5. The rumor being that Archos may get the permission from Google to include the full Google Experience with the Android 2.0 firmware due by the middle of December approximately.
www.futurelooks.com – MSI announces their top end GTX 580 called the Lightning Extreme Edition. It features not only high clocks, but also a cool fan that is painted using heat sensitive paint that will change colors when heated in a case. This tells you that your case is too frickin’ hot. It also features a new self cleaning system that removes dust upon GPU start up. MSI Afterburner fans also get two new freebies. If you’re using an Android smartphone, you’ll have remote overclock and monitoring capabilities, and for those that like screencasts, their new Predator feature is now updated to work even better than before.
